Sorrento Primary School (PS) is seeking a dedicated and hardworking Cleaner to join their friendly team.
Under the Cleaner In Charge the successful applicant will be a conscientious worker, having knowledge of cleaning processes and cleaning equipment. You will have pride in your work and assist the team as they strive to keep the school environment clean and safe in accordance with Department procedures.
The successful applicant will carry out internal cleaning duties, including the maintenance of carpets and hard floor surfaces, toilet cleaning, furniture and fittings, window cleaning, dusting, and rubbish removal. They will perform external cleaning duties, including the cleaning of verandas and covered areas, rubbish removal, cleaning of drinking troughs, window cleaning, and removal of cobwebs. They will also complete vacation cleaning duties, including, window cleaning, shampooing of carpets, pressure cleaning of verandas and undercover areas, and other such duties as required by the Cleaner In Charge. The ability to work collaboratively in a team environment is essential.

To be suitable for this role, you will need to demonstrate the following work related requirements (selection criteria):
- Ability to read and apply Material Safety Data Sheets, equipment operating instructions, safety instructions and training guidelines.
- Knowledge of, and ability to, use cleaning equipment including polishers, vacuum cleaners and pressure cleaners.
- Ability to communicate effectively, follow instructions and work as a member of a team.
